Wadi Dahek: The Enchanting White Desert
Discover the breathtaking beauty of Wadi Dahek, the White Desert, where unique geological formations meet stunning white landscapes in Jordan.
Wadi Dahek, often referred to as the White Desert, is a mesmerizing natural wonder in Jordan, captivating tourists with its stunning white landscapes and unique geological formations. Perfect for nature lovers and adventure seekers alike, this park offers a serene escape into a breathtakingly beautiful terrain that feels otherworldly.

Local tips
- Bring plenty of water and sun protection, as the desert sun can be intense.
- Visit during the early morning or late afternoon to experience the best light for photography.
- Wear comfortable hiking shoes to navigate the sandy terrain easily.
- Consider hiring a local guide to enrich your understanding of the area's unique geology.
- Plan for a picnic; there are few amenities available in this remote area.

Getting There
-
Car
If you are driving from the Mujib Nature Reserve visitor center, start by heading south on the main road (Road 65) towards the Dead Sea. After about 15 kilometers, you will reach the junction for the road leading to Wadi Dahek. Look for signs indicating 'Wadi Dahek' and turn left onto the unpaved road. Follow this road for approximately 5 kilometers, which may require a 4x4 vehicle due to rocky terrain. Keep an eye out for markers indicating the path to the White Desert. Once you arrive, park in the designated area and prepare for a short hike to fully appreciate the stunning views of the white desert landscape.
-
Public Transportation
While public transportation options are limited, you can take a bus from Amman to Madaba. From Madaba, hire a taxi to take you to Mujib Nature Reserve. Once at the reserve, you will need to arrange for a local guide or taxi service to reach Wadi Dahek, as there are no direct public transport routes to this specific location. It's advisable to negotiate the fare beforehand; expect to pay around 30-50 Jordanian Dinars for this service. Make sure to confirm the return trip with your driver.
-
Guided Tour
Consider joining a guided tour that includes Wadi Dahek as part of its itinerary. Tours can be booked through various travel agencies in Jordan, particularly those based in Amman or Madaba. This option usually includes transportation, a knowledgeable guide, and sometimes meals. Prices vary, but expect to pay around 50-100 Jordanian Dinars per person for a full-day tour that includes Wadi Dahek, depending on the inclusions.
